CPO inspection could be months ago, a lot can happened in a few months. Unlike a new car, a lot of wear and tear items might need to be replaced soon, some people like to know this in advance before purchasing their car. What I don't understand is why someone looking to spend 40K plus on a used car and cheapens out on the $250 for a PPI.
